May 3, 2012:   Continuing with yesterday's
theme of the gift of being 'seen, accepted and
loved'...as we are, for who we are.

The person who has given me this gift in the
truest sense and for the longest time, is Paul.

For over 31 years, he has been there through
thick and thin, sharing my sunniest moments
and, more importantly, companioning me
through my darkest shadows.  His loving
kindness changed my life...and I wanted to do
something to honor him.

It's hard to get him to sit still for a few minutes,
as his activism for a better world takes a lot of
time and energy right now.  (I gave him a
'heads-up' about wanting to do a portrait, a
couple of weeks ago).  In addition to his
job at the university, all the everyday house-
hold things he does, creating art and music,
Paul puts in countless hours each day in
support of the environment and public health
...without pay, with no personal / political
agenda, no 'green' business to promote,
without recognition or accolades.

Today's painting is a tribute to his generous
spirit (picture me bowing deeply in gratitude).
